- NEW LIFE IN NAURO-GOR 33 minutes - The people of Nauro-Gor in the Simbu Province of Papua New Guinea had been at war for over 30 years. Finally, with the support of their parish priest they decided to implement a series of community laws with the hope of bringing peace and wellbeing. The footage for this video is taken entirely by the people themselves. Fr. Philip Gibbs helped edit it. It shows scenes from the life of the community in recent times from the perspective of community members.
